| class GameState: | |
| def __init__(self): | |
| self.score = 0 | |
| self.current_word = "" | |
| self.clues_shown = 0 | |
| self.guesses_left = 2 | |
| self.category = "" | |
| def reset(self): | |
| self.__init__() | |
| game = GameState() | |
| def get_random_clues(word): | |
| """Get pre-written clues or generate simple ones.""" | |
| if word in CLUES: | |
| return CLUES[word] | |
| # Fallback clues if word not in CLUES dictionary | |
| return [ | |
| f"This word has {len(word)} letters", | |
| f"It starts with '{word[0]}'", | |
| f"It ends with '{word[-1]}'", | |
| f"It belongs to category: {game.category}", | |
| "This is your last clue!" | |
| ] | |
| def start_game(category): | |
| """Start a new game with selected category.""" | |
| if not category: | |
| return "Please select a category first!", "", get_status(), False | |
| game.reset() | |
| game.category = category | |
| game.current_word = random.choice(WORD_LISTS[category]) | |
| game.clues_shown = 0 | |
| clue = get_random_clues(game.current_word)[0] | |
| return ( | |
| f"Category: {category}\nFirst clue: {clue}", | |
| "", | |
| get_status(), | |
| True | |
| ) | |
| def make_guess(guess, interface_state): | |
| """Process the player's guess.""" | |
| if not interface_state: | |
| return "Please start a new game first!", "", get_status(), False | |
| if not guess: | |
| return "Please enter a guess!", "", get_status(), interface_state | |
| guess = guess.lower().strip() | |
| if guess == game.current_word: | |
| score_increase = (game.guesses_left * 20) - (game.clues_shown * 5) | |
| game.score += score_increase | |
| return ( | |
| f"๐ Correct! +{score_increase} points! The word was: {game.current_word}", | |
| "", | |
| get_status(), | |
| False | |
| ) | |
| game.guesses_left -= 1 | |
| if game.guesses_left <= 0: | |
| return ( | |
| f"Game Over! The word was: {game.current_word}", | |
| "", | |
| get_status(), | |
| False | |
| ) | |
| feedback = generate_feedback(guess) | |
| return feedback, "", get_status(), interface_state | |
| def get_hint(interface_state): | |
| """Provide next clue for the current word.""" | |
| if not interface_state: | |
| return "Please start a new game first!", "", get_status(), False | |
| clues = get_random_clues(game.current_word) | |
| game.clues_shown += 1 | |
| if game.clues_shown >= len(clues): | |
| return "No more clues available!", "", get_status(), interface_state | |
| return f"Clue #{game.clues_shown + 1}: {clues[game.clues_shown]}", "", get_status(), interface_state | |
| def generate_feedback(guess): | |
| """Generate helpful feedback for incorrect guesses.""" | |
| word = game.current_word | |
| if len(guess) != len(word): | |
| return f"The word has {len(word)} letters (your guess had {len(guess)})" | |
| correct_pos = sum(1 for a, b in zip(guess, word) if a == b) | |
| correct_letters = len(set(guess) & set(word)) | |
| return f"'{guess}' is not correct. {correct_pos} letters in correct position, {correct_letters} correct letters. {game.guesses_left} guesses left!" | |
| def get_status(): | |
| """Get current game status.""" | |
| return f""" | |
| ๐ฎ Game Status: | |
| Score: {game.score} | |
| Guesses Left: {game.guesses_left} | |
| Hints Used: {game.clues_shown} | |
| """ | |
